Keep vegetable seeds for propagation.🌱

Read moreเมล็ดผักเป็นแหล่งสำคัญสำหรับการขยายพันธุ์ผักในสวนครัวของเรา โดยเฉพาะสำหรับคนที่ชอบปลูกผักกินเองที่บ้าน การเก็บเมล็ดจากผักที่โตเต็มที่และสมบูรณ์จะทำให้เรามีเมล็ดพันธุ์คุณภาพดีสำหรับล็อตถัดไป วิธีง่าย ๆ ที่แนะนำคือเลือกผักที่สมบูรณ์ ไม่แสดงอาการโรคหรือแมลง หลังจากผักสุกและเริ่มแห้ง ให้เก็บเมล็ดด้วยมือแล้วผึ่งลมในที่ร่ม เพื่อป้องกันความชื้นและเชื้อรา สำหรับผักยอดนิยมที่นิยมนำเมล็ดมาเก็บ เช่น ผักชี ผักปลัง และผักสวนครัวหลายชนิด เราควรศึกษาวิธีเก็บเมล็ดแต่ละชนิดให้เหมาะสมเพราะเมล็ดแต่ละแบบอาจมีวิธีการเตรียมก่อนเก็บที่แตกต่างกัน นอกจากนี้ การเก็บเมล็ดผักยังเป็นทางเลือกที่ช่วยประหยัดค่าใช้จ่าย เพราะไม่ต้องซื้อเมล็ดพันธุ์ใหม่ทุกครั้งที่ปลูก เราสามารถทดลองปลูกและพัฒนาสวนครัวของเราอย่างต่อเนื่องด้วยวิธีง่าย ๆ นี้ที่ทุกคนทำได้เอง หากคุณสนใจการขยายพันธุ์พืชแบบไม่อาศัยเพศ ที่มีหลากหลายวิธีเช่น การเพาะเมล็ด การตอนกิ่ง หรือการปักชำ ก็ควรลองศึกษาวิธีเหล่านั้นเพิ่มเติม เพื่อเพิ่มความหลากหลายในสวนผัก และช่วยเพิ่มโอกาสในการปลูกผักให้ปรับตัวและเจริญเติบโตได้ดีในสภาพแวดล้อมของคุณเอง
